    1914, Friday July 31, The Almonte Gazette page 7

    ?b?BLAKENEY NEWS?/b?
    ? The residents of this community were shocked on Tuesday evening, when the news was spread that Mr David McGill had suddenly passed away. Although not feeling his best for a few days, deceased was working around home as usual on Monday, when he was suddenly seized during the afternoon with a severe attack of acute indigestion. Medical aid was quickly summoned, but in spite of all care and skill he suffered severely until the end came on Tuesday night. The late Mr McGill, who was born in Pakenham township 64 years ago, was the fourth son of the late John McGill, and spent his lifetime in this vicinity with the exception of a short time he was in the United States. In 1882 he was married to Mrs Sarah Dunlop of Pakenham, who predeceased him about 23 years ago. This union was blessed by a family of one son, Harold, Near Tyvan, Sask, and one daughter, Miss Florence of Renfrew. Later he was married to Miss Margaret Lyttle of Fitzroy, who survives with a family of two daughters and one son ? Misses Violet, Pearl and baby Lester. One sister, Mrs Peter Syme, and three brothers, John of Blakeney, Alex of Almonte, and Thos of Vancouver, B.C., also survive. all of whom have the deepest sympathy of a large circle of friends in their sad and sudden bereavement. The funeral took place this Thursday afternoon from his late residence in Blakeney to the eighth line cemetery, Rev Wm Merrilees conducting the service at the home and cemetery.

    Died:
    Mrs. John McGill
    On Tuesday Mrs John McGill (nee Jane McCann) was called hence, having reached her 88th. year. Deceased was born in County Down, Ireland, and after her marriage to Mr. John McGill they came to Canada, reaching here sixty years ago last July. they came to Ramsay and her home has been in that township ever since, for the past few uears with her daughter, Mrs Peter T. symes, of the tenth line. four sons and three daughters were born to them, three of whom , James Mrs Robert Fulton and Mrs Geo Greigson, are dead. Those living are John in Pakenham, Mrs Peter Syme and Alex., Ramsay, and Thos and David, Blakeney. Brothers of deceased who are still living are Messrs. thomas McCann of Pakenham, and James of Almonte. The funeral takes place this (thursday) afternoon to the eighth line cemetery.
